Pushkin Press imprint One has signed debut novel Whispers Through a Megaphone by Rachel Elliott.
Editor Elena Lappin pre-empted world English rights in the book, in a deal with Gaia Banks at Sheil Land.
The book tells the story of Miriam Delaney, who cannot speak above a whisper, and Ralph, whose wife is blogging about every aspect of their unhappy marriage.
Whispers Through a Megaphone will be published in autumn 2015 as a lead title for the imprint, backed by what the publisher calls "a substantial publicity and marketing campaign."
